Definition of Search Engine Marketing

Quoted by Moz, search engine marketing is a strategy in digital marketing that is carried out to increase visibility on search pages or search engine results pages (SERP) by using paid advertising.

In simple terms, search engine marketing is a marketing strategy to make your business site at the top of the main page of search engines.

Even though you have maximized your organic marketing strategy, you will still need paid advertising with this SEM strategy. When talking about organic marketing, of course what is used is SEO or search engine optimization.

Quoting HubSpot, a survey shows that 49% of potential consumers use the Google search engine to find new products, so optimizing search engine marketing is crucial.

The thing that needs to be considered in search engine marketing is that the implementation needs to be done step by step with a trial period.

Not all marketing problems can be solved by using paid advertising. Don't let this become a wasteful and ineffective use of your budget.

Types of Search Engine Marketing

Many sources say that search engine marketing is a type of paid marketing only.

However, there are also several sources that say that search engine marketing is a combination of organic and paid marketing.

There is nothing wrong with the two definitions above, to understand it better, here are the types or types of search engine marketing:

1. Pay-Per-Click Ads or PPC

As previously explained, paid advertising will provide more benefits and targets for your site.

If you do a search on Google, the sites that appear first above the organic search results are sites that use paid advertising.

This is the essence of paid advertising, not just to get results from SEO but from paying for advertising to be in the top search results.

The model most often used in paid advertising is Pay-Per-Click where you have to pay only when someone clicks on the ad. The most frequently used PPC platform is Google Ads.

How much you should pay for a click on Google Ads depends on many factors. Google will determine the cost per click or cost per click of the ad.

The cost per click and the position of your paid advertisement compared to other paid advertisements will also depend on supply and demand or the demand and supply of your product.

2. Search Engine Optimization (SEO)

SEO or search engine optimization is also part of search engine marketing.

If PPC uses paid advertising as a marketing tool, then SEO is the process of optimizing your business site using specific keywords.

The principle of SEO itself is to create good and optimal content to increase user understanding as well as create brand awareness.

There are three types of SEO, namely technical SEO, On-page SEO, and Off-page SEO.

Through SEO, you can get a lot of traffic coming to your site even without using paid advertising.

SEO content will appear just below paid content and is usually considered more trustworthy and accurate because the content is targeted or tailored to the target you want to achieve.

3. Local SEO

Local SEO is part of SEO in general, but is also part of search engine marketing because it involves special techniques to increase the visibility of search results.

Usually, local businesses that want to get new consumers or attract customers will use local SEO rather than other types of search engine marketing.

Not only is it more affordable, local SEO can also attract site visitors and new prospects for business.

You can find examples of local SEO when searching on Google. For example, if you search for the keyword "Dental Clinic in Malang" then the list of addresses that appear at the top on the search page is what is called local SEO.

Advantages and Disadvantages of Search Engine Marketing

Search engine marketing can be used for almost all types of brands. However, it is also necessary to pay attention to the following advantages and disadvantages:

Advantages of SEM

Search engine marketing is very easy to measure its success. Moreover, currently there are many tools used to measure the performance of SEM.

You can easily review and review the performance of the strategies that have been implemented so that the budget and investment used can also be more effective.

Not only that, you also carry out real-time monitoring if you use paid advertising in search engine marketing. Evaluation and strategy changes can be done quickly.

Using strategies such as pay-per-click can also control the daily budget and how much investment is needed to be more effective.

However, from the advantages mentioned above, the main advantage of search engine marketing is that the results are quicker to see, the process is efficient, and it is in line with the target.

Disadvantages of SEM

One of the main disadvantages of search engine marketing is the use of paid marketing which may incur greater costs.

This is because paid advertising will be more optimal for the campaign your brand is running.

Not only that, competition in search engine marketing will be greater and more difficult, so you need other strategies to ensure your brand continues to have high supply and demand.

Paid advertising is sometimes considered annoying, so many people still choose content from organic SEO results because they are considered more trustworthy.
